Level 2 Diploma Performing Engineering Operations

UPDATED 20150817 15:38:42

These level 2 courses will develop practical and theoretical engineering skills including welding hand fitting as well as machining (turning) in a workshop enviroment. The course is delivered over one year and includes a combination of theory and practical activities. You will cover topics such as working safely in engineering using and communicating technical information and carrying out engineering activities efficiently together with functional skills in numeracy ICT and literacy. This programme will allow you to develop work related skills in preparation for further training or employment.

Course information

Name: Level 2 Diploma Performing Engineering Operations Qualification title: NVQ Diploma in Performing Engineering Operations (QCF) Qualification type: Assessment This course is assessed by coursework and is split between 65% practical assessments and 35% theory.
